    Abstract: An objective of the present invention is to provide a future state estimation method and future state estimation device with which, given that the space in which the estimation is carried out is finite, it is possible to rapidly estimate the states of a controlled object and the peripheral environment thereof in the form of probability density distribution for infinite future.

    Abstract: A sequence design support system is used to support a design of a sequence control program which controls a flow path condition of a fluid in an apparatus and piping system which is constructed connecting apparatus such as a valve with piping and comprises a valve pattern plan generation unit which generates a valve pattern plan which is plan data showing the flow path condition per time step of the fluid in the apparatus and piping system from apparatus and piping system plan data which is plan data showing the apparatus and piping system and time chart sheet which is obtained defining the condition of the apparatus in the apparatus and piping system per time step.

    Abstract: A knowledge processing system structurizing method and tool. By preparing a general-purpose search program on the basis of information inputted by the user, an inference program for a given problem to be solved and a given object domain is created. The general-purpose search program is constituted by a plurality of search elementary functions. A guide message is displayed on a display unit in accordance with classified information of a problem solving strategy. Program creating knowledges are obtained from the information inputted by the user in response to the guide message. By employing the program creating knowledges, a general-purpose program is created with the aid of a correspondence table containing correspondences between search elementary functions having search primitive functions built therein and search fundamental functions.
